A planetary probe explores the liquid hydrocarbon seas of Saturn's moon Titan, investigating how hydrostatic pressure varies with depth. Under a surface atmospheric pressure of 147 kPa, the probe first measures pressure at different depths in a reservoir of liquid methane (density 422 kg/m3).
The probe then repeats the investigation in a reservoir of liquid ethane (density 544 kg/m3), which is more dense than liquid methane.
Figure 1 shows the original graph of pressure plotted against depth for the liquid methane.

Compare the line that would be plotted for the liquid ethane with the line for liquid methane in Figure 1.
